Algeria Arrive in Banjul Friday

africa » gambia » banjul
Root Folder
Thursday, September 06, 2007

The Desert Warriors of Algeria would arrive in Banjul on Friday September 7, 2007 for the crucial Nations Cup qualifier game against the Scorpions of The Gambia on Sunday September 9.

According to the President of The Gambia Football Association (GFA) Seedy MB Kinteh, the Algerian team would land at the Banjul International Airport on Friday via a chartered flight.

Mr Kinteh revealed that the flight would be waiting for the team up to Sunday as the Algerians have decided to leave The Gambia just after the game.

It could be recalled that the Algerian head coach, Jean Michel Cavalli, has called a 22-man squad ahead of the  crucial game in Banjul.

The list includes Fulham striker Hameur Bouazza, who will be marking his return in the national team for the first time since March.

Also called for the vital African Nations qualifier against The Gambia were defender Mehdi Meniri of French Division one side Bastia, German based midfielder of  FSV Mainz, Chadli Amri and striker Boutabout of Sedan in the French league.
